Prusa MK4 in Repetier Server einbinden

Guten Abend Zusammen,

ich hatte einen Prusa MK3S+, welchen ich mit einem Upgrade Kit auf einen MK3.9 aufgerüstet habe.

Nun stehe ich vor dem Problem, das ich den "neuen" Drucker nicht in meinen Repetier Server eingebunden bekomme.
Ich betreibe bereits mehrere MK3S+ am Server.

Mit der bisherigen Methode, einen neuen Drucker hinzu zufügen, funktioniert es leider nicht.
Der Drucker wird nicht gefunden.

Hier im Forum habe ich bereits gelesen, das es einige geschafft haben, einen MK4 einzubinden.

Kann mir jemand helfen?

Comments

  • Eigentlich sollte das genau gleich funktionieren. Serieller USB Port ist natürlich anders und ich denke ping-pong muss aktiviert werden. Und ich denke die einstellung das der Port immer sichtbar ist sollte weg fallen, hab aber keinen mk4 um es zu testen. Aber das sollte schon alles sein.
  • leider eben nicht. 
    Mit Pronterface kann ich den MK4 per USB steuern, das funktioniert einwandfrei.
    Habe auch nochmal zum testen einen MK3S+ gelöscht und wieder hinzugefügt, hier wird der Druckerport/USB sofort gefunden.
  • AN welcher stelle hakt es denn? Port nicht da oder verbindung erscheint nicht? Ggf. in Konsole wechseln und alles aktivieren und mal sehen was da genau passiert Kommunikationstechnisch.
  • also beim MK3S mach ich es immer so:
    1. nur der Drucker den ich hinzufügen möchte ist am PI angeschlossen
    2. in RS " das Plus drücken, Drucker hinzufügen, jetzt erscheint bereits der Drucker mit dem richtigen Port und der ID
    3. restliche Druckerinfo´s eintragen/prüfen
    4. Fertig

    beim MK4 hängt es an Schritt 2
    der Port wird nicht automatisch erkannt. RS hat somit keine Verbindung zum Drucker.

    Mit Pronterface über einen Windows PC habe ich jedoch eine Verbindung zum Drucker und kann steuern.
  • Also gibt es keine Geräte under /dev/serial/by-id/... was das verbinden schwierig macht, wenn Linux ihn nicht sieht.
    Wenn du am pi in der linux shell wechselst sieht er dann das Gerät mit
    lsusb
    ?
    Solanf Linux den Drucker nicht sieht kann man im Server natürlich nichts machen. Aber normal erkennt Linux ja alle seriellen Schnittstellen.
  • wundert mich auch das der PI die Verbindung nicht erkennt... bei Windows wie gesagt kein Problem....

    Wollte eben den Tipp im Terminal testen, blöderweise weiß ich meine Logindaten nicht mehr -.-
    verdammte Axt....
  • Hast du das Passwort geänder? Ansonsten ist es ja immer noch user pi passwort raspberry

  • wenn ich das "Passwort" richtig geschrieben hätte, hätte es auch funktioniert ;-)
    danke für den Tipp.

    zurück zum Thema:
    Linux erkennt das Gerät nicht:
    Bus 002 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
    Bus 001 Device 004: ID 2c99:0002 Prusa Original Prusa i3 MK3
    Bus 001 Device 003: ID 04cc:1521 ST-Ericsson USB 2.0 Hub
    Bus 001 Device 002: ID 2109:3431 VIA Labs, Inc. Hub
    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
  • Was ist mit Prusa Original Prusa i3 MK3 - ist das ein anderer Prusa Drucker am gerät. Auch wenn der Name falsch ist wäre er es wenn kein anderer dran hängt. Wenn ein anderer ist, funktioniert usb nicht oder das Gerät ist nicht an. Versuch mal anderes USB Kabel oder anderen Port. Selbst wenn Linux keinen Treiber hat wird man das USB Gerät ja sehen.
  • Ich habe es schon in allen möglichen Varianten probiert.
    Grundsätzlich hängen 3 Drucker an einem USB Hub, 1x MK3 Inbetrieb, 1x aktuell Netzteil defekt und 1x MK4

    Der neue MK4 wird weder über den HUB noch direkt am PI an verschiedenen Ports erkannt.
    Auch verschiedene USB Kabel bringen keine Abhilfe.

    Direkt am Windows Rechner angeschlossen wird der MK4 über USB sofort erkannt und kann über Pronterface gesteuert werden.

    Es scheint so, als ob der MK4 für den PI unsichtbar ist.


  • Sieht fast so aus. Wie alt ist das Image? Das aktuelle Image nutzt buster (lsb_release -a). In kürze will ich eins mit bookworm veröffentlichen, aber da hat sich viel geändert muss ich erst mal ausgiebig testen. Wobei ich es komisch finde das es nicht mal als usb Gerät erscheint.
  • Letztes Jahr Mitte September 2022 hab ich den Server mit Version 1.4.1 V33 aufgesetzt, mit Upgrade auf die Pro-Variante.
    Aktuell läuft 1.4.13
  • Ich häng mich da mal mit dran , ich habe auch einen MK4 , der wird auch über den Pi erkannt , aber es dauert immer etwas und manchmal stirbt der MK4 mit "bluescreen" wenn man den Pi rebootet :-(

    Der MK4 ist so sichtbar 

    pi@Repetier-Server:~ $ lsusb
    Bus 002 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
    Bus 001 Device 004: ID 2c99:000d
    Bus 001 Device 002: ID 2109:3431 VIA Labs, Inc. Hub
    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ub


    pi@Repetier-Server:~ $ ls /dev/serial/by-id/
    usb-Prusa_Research__prusa3d.com__Original_Prusa_MK4_10589-3742441631700488-if00

    so erscheint der Port dann auch im drop-down menu.

    Ich kämpfe gerade damit die pi-cam V3 einzubinden , wird vom Pi erkannt , taucht als Pi-cam im menu auf kann aber nicht zum zuweisen ausgewählt werden
  • Wenn eine Cam nicht auswählbar ist, läuft der mjpg streamer für die cam nicht( mehr). Man kann versuchen die Webcams neu zu starten, aber wenn der streamer es nicht kann wird er sich vermutlich wieder schnell abschalten. Dann sollte man in /var/log/syslog zu dem Zeitpunkt nachsehen warum er sich beendet hat.

    Pi cam im neuen Grafikmodus ist etwas kritisch, da er keine hardware Komprimierung unterstützt. Evtl. mit sudo raspi-config die webcam in den legacy Modus setzen. Das wählt den alten Treiber und alter Grafiktreiber aus und nutzt ein anderes Modul in mjpg-streamer.
  • edited December 2023
    Ja habe ich schon alles versucht , unter Buster bekomme ich sie nicht zum laufen , unter bookworm wird sie mit libcamera sofort gefunden , dann gedulde ich mich noch etwas auf den neuen repetier-server , dann kann ich ja vielleicht beides nutzen , Pi5 und Cam V3 ;-) 

    pi@Pi5:~ $ libcamera-hello --list-cameras
    Available cameras
    -----------------
    0 : imx708 [4608x2592 10-bit RGGB] (/base/axi/pcie@120000/rp1/i2c@88000/imx708@1a)
        Modes: 'SRGGB10_CSI2P' : 1536x864 [120.13 fps - (768, 432)/3072x1728 crop]
                                 2304x1296 [56.03 fps - (0, 0)/4608x2592 crop]
                                 4608x2592 [14.35 fps - (0, 0)/4608x2592 crop]

  • Hallo zusammen,

    ich schließe mich dem Thema ebenfalls an, allerdings mit der Integration eines Prusa XL.
    Ich habe die gleiche Problematik, dass der Drucker nicht vom PI erkannt wird.

    Aktuell sind auf einem PI4 via USB Hub 5 MK3 sowie weitere 5 USB Cams angeschlossen.

    pi@PrusaServer:~ $ lsusb
    Bus 002 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
    Bus 001 Device 016: ID 2c99:0002  
    Bus 001 Device 015: ID 2c99:0002  
    Bus 001 Device 014: ID 2c99:0002  
    Bus 001 Device 013: ID 2c99:0002  
    Bus 001 Device 011: ID 2109:2813 VIA Labs, Inc. 
    Bus 001 Device 019: ID 1b3f:2002 Generalplus Technology Inc. 808 Camera
    Bus 001 Device 018: ID 1b3f:2002 Generalplus Technology Inc. 808 Camera
    Bus 001 Device 017: ID 1b3f:2247 Generalplus Technology Inc. 
    Bus 001 Device 012: ID 1b3f:2247 Generalplus Technology Inc. 
    Bus 001 Device 010: ID 2109:2813 VIA Labs, Inc. 
    Bus 001 Device 009: ID 2c99:0002  
    Bus 001 Device 008: ID 1b3f:2002 Generalplus Technology Inc. 808 Camera
    Bus 001 Device 007: ID 2109:2813 VIA Labs, Inc. 
    Bus 001 Device 002: ID 2109:3431 VIA Labs, Inc. Hub
    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ub

    Hänge ich den XL auf einen USB des Raspis, so bekomme ich kein weiteres Gerät dazu. Auf Windows wird der Drucker erkannt.

    Es läuft Repetier-Server Pro 1.4.17

    Welche Möglichkeiten kann ich noch ausprobieren?
  • Hast du schon versucht den Xl direkt am Pi anzuschließen. USB 2 und 3 beide mal probieren. Wenn lsusb es nicht listet ist es für Linux nicht existeht und ich denke selbst unbekannt Geräte werden normal gelistet. Eventuell bringt ja der Hub den Pi durcheinandere. Ist jedenfalls merkwürdig das es nicht auftaucht. 
  • Der USB-HUB ist mit seinen 10 Anschlüssen bereits voll belegt.
    Ich habe den XL direkt an das Pi gehängt und alle freien Anschlüsse getestet, leider ohne Erfolg.
    Ebenfalls habe ich unterschiedliche Kabel ausprobiert. 
    Unter Windows war wie bereits gesagt kein Fehler zu finden.

    Das Problem liegt definitiv beim Raspi. Allerdings habe ich hierfür keine Lösungen (am Ende des Tages bin ich auch nur ein einfacher Anwender :) )
  • Problem gelöst:
    sudo apt-get remove modemmanager
    
    sudo apt autoremove brltty
    
    
    XL taucht als serieller Port auf und kann wie gewohnt eingerichtet werden!
  • Was Betriebssysteme angeht sind wir all enur Anwender. Der Teil den ich kontrollieren kann ist wenn Linux das Gerät als Schnittstelle anzeigt. Hab keinen XL aber MK3 und PrusaMini werden Problemlos angezeigt.

    Was ich noch gefunden habe ist das bei manchen
    sudo lsusb
    mehr ausgibt. Andere bekommen meldungen beim ein/ausstöpseln mit
    sudo dmesg -w

    Vielleicht hilft das weiter und liefert einen Hinweis.
Sign In or Register to comment.